Lindsay Lohan - You're No Marilyn Monroe

then again, Marilyn was kinda wacked too. Lindsay Lohan, in her endless pursuit of the paparazzi and headlines, is edging her way into the pseudo-void created by Paris Hilton's jail controversy and Britney Spears' psycho meltdown. Lohan just did a photo spread for New York Magazine in a rendition of the famous Monroe "Last Sitting", so called because a week after doing this famous 1962 nude pose, Marilyn was found dead in her apartment in L.A. Lindsay is a tart of sorts, not as hot as she likes one to believe, and certainly no Marilyn Monroe (blond hair dye notwithstanding). But this pic of her is fashionaby nice.
